What You Need to Know About Rifle Optics
Rifle scopes enable you to precisely align a rifle at various targets by lining up your eye with the target over a distance. They accomplish this through magnification by utilizing a set of lenses within the scope. The scope’s alignment can be adjusted for consideration of varied environmental factors like wind speed and elevation to make up for bullet drop.
The scope’s purpose is to help the shooter understand exactly where the bullet will hit based on the sight picture you are viewing via the optic as you line up the scope’s crosshair or reticle with the intended target. A lot of modern rifle scopes and optics have around eleven parts which are located inside and on the exterior of the scope body. These scope parts include the rifle scope’s body, lenses, windage turrets or dials, focus rings, and other elements. See all eleven parts of an optic.
Rifle Scope Varieties
Rifle scopes can be either “first focal plane” or “second focal plane” type of scopes. Going for the perfect type of rifle glass depends on what type of shooting you plan to do.
First Focal Plane Glass
Focal plane scopes (FFP) come with the reticle in front of the zoom lens. This causes the reticle to increase in size based upon the extent of zoom being used. The outcome is that the reticle measurements are the same at the magnified distance as they are at the non amplified range. One tick on a mil-dot reticle at 100 yards without “zoom” is still the exact same tick at one hundred yards with 5x “zoom”. These kinds of scopes are practical for:
- Quick acquisition, far away types of shooting
- Shooting circumstances where calculations are small
- Experienced shooters who know their aim point “hold over” as well as “lead” equations for their weapon
- Shooters who don’t mind the reticle is bigger and requires more visual eyesight space than a SFP reticle
About Second Focal Plane Glass
Second focal plane scopes (SFP) include the reticle behind the zoom lens. This triggers the reticle to stay at the very same dimensions in connection with the volume of magnification being used. The outcome is that the reticle dimensions alter based upon the zoom chosen to shoot over lengthier distances since the reticle measurements represent distinct increments which vary with the zoom level. In the FFP illustration with the SFP scope, the 5x “zoom” 100 yard tick reticle measurement would be 1/5th of the non “zoom” tick reticle measurement. These particular styles of glass work for:
- Far away forms of shooting where shooters have extra time to make ballistic estimations
- Shooting where most shots take place within much shorter ranges and proximities
- Shooters who would like a clearer optic picture without area taken up by the larger size FFP reticle
Glass Magnification
The quantity of zoom a scope supplies is figured out by the diameter, thickness, and curvatures of the lenses inside of the rifle scope. The magnification of the scope is the “power” of the scope.
About Fixed Single Power Lens Rifle Glass
A single power rifle scope comes with a magnification number designator like 4×32. This suggests the zoom power of the scope is 4x power and the objective lens is 32mm. The zoom of this type of optic can not fluctuate since it is set from the factory.
Adjustable Power Lens Scopes
Variable power rifle scopes use variable power levels. The power modification is handled by making use of the power ring part of the scope near the back of the scope by the eye bell.

Details on Rifle Optic Lens Finishing
All modern rifle optic and scope lenses are coated. There are different types and qualities of coatings. Lens finish can be an important aspect of a rifle’s setup when looking into luxury rifle optics and targeting systems. The lenses are among the most vital pieces of the optic considering they are what your eye sees through while sighting a rifle in on the target. The finishing on the lenses safeguards the lens exterior and also improves anti glare from excess sunlight and color perception.
ED Versus HD Optics
Some scope brands likewise use “HD” or high-definition lens finishes which use various techniques, polarizations, aspects, and chemicals to draw out a wide range of colors and viewable quality through the lens. Some scope manufacturers use “HD” to refer to “ED” indicating extra-low dispersion glass.
Glass Lens Single Finish Versus Multi-Coating
Different scope lenses can also have various finishings applied to them. All lenses typically have at least some kind of treatment or finish applied to them before they are used in a rifle scope or optic assembly. This is because the lens isn’t simply a raw piece of glass. It becomes part of the finely tuned optic. It requires a coating to be applied to it so that the lens will be efficiently functional in lots of types of environments, degrees of sunlight (full light VS shade), and other shooting conditions.
This lens treatment can protect the lens from scratches while reducing glare and other less advantageous things experienced in the shooting environment while sighting in with the scope. The quality of a single covered lens depends on the scope producer and how much you paid for it.
Some scope producers also make it a point to define if their optic lenses are layered or “multi” coated. Being “better” depends on the maker’s lens treatment technology and the quality of materials used in building the rifle scope.
Details on Anti-water Coating
Water on a lens doesn’t assist with keeping a clear sight picture through a scope at all. Many top of the line and high-end optic companies will coat their lenses with a hydrophilic or hydrophobic anti-water finishing.
Choices for Installing Optics on Long Guns
Mounting solutions for scopes can be found in a few options. There are the standard scope rings which are individually installed to the optic and one-piece mounts which cradle the scope. These various types of mounts also usually come in quick release variations which use manual levers which enable rifle shooters to rapidly mount and dismount the glass.
Rifle Glass Mounting Solutions with Hex Key Rings
Basic, clamp style mounting scope rings use hex head screws to install to the flattop style Picatinny scope mounting rails on the tops of rifles. These kinds of scope mounts use a pair of separate rings to support the optic, and are normally made from 7075 T6 billet aluminum or similar materials which are made for far away accuracy shooting. This form of scope mount is exceptional for rifle systems which need a long lasting, unfailing mount which will not shift regardless of just how much the scope is moved about or jarring the rifle takes. These are the style of mounts you should get for a dedicated scope system on a reach out and touch someone scouting or competition firearm that will rarely need to be altered or recalibrated. Blue 242 Loctite threadlocker can additionally be used on the mount’s screws to prevent the hex screw threads from wiggling out after they are installed safely in position. An example of these mounting rings are the 30mm style from the Vortex Optics brand. The set typically costs around $200 USD
Quick-Release Cantilever Scope Ring Mounts
These types of quick-release rifle scope mounts can be used to quickly detach a scope and attach it to a different rifle. Numerous scopes can also be swapped out if they all use a compatible design mount. These types of mounts are convenient for rifles which are transported a lot, to swap out the optic from the rifle for protection, or for scopes which are used in between multiple rifles or are situationally focused.
Sealing and Gas Purging for Rifle Glass Tubes
Moisture inside your rifle optic can destroy a day of shooting and your expensive optic by causing fogging and developing residue inside of the scope tube. A lot of scopes avoid moisture from getting in the scope tube with a system of sealing O-rings which are water resistant.
Info Around Optic Tube Gas Purging
Another part of avoiding the buildup of wetness inside of the rifle scope tube is filling the tube with a gas like nitrogen. Given that this space is currently occupied by the gas, the optic is less impacted by climate alterations and pressure variations from the outdoor environment which may potentially allow water vapor to seep in around the seals to fill the vacuum which would otherwise exist.
